Urban Interventions: Colourful murals pop up across Asia and Europe
This colourful collection of street art murals is the handiwork of Chifumi Krohom. Based in Cambodia, the artist has painted these giant scenes, which all feature his signature 'hands', on buildings in his home city, as well as in Denmark and France.

Originally from France, the aim of Krohom's work is to integrate different cultures through art. He is inspired by all aspects of local tradition, whether that be a pattern extracted from the wall of a temple, or a silk scarf found in the labyrinth of a local market.
Sometimes Krohom's hands appear on abandoned houses located close to the jungle, and sometimes they appear on chic restaurants in the busy Cambodian capital, Phnom Penh. Others were created during the artist's travels to Nepal.
